I think over the last few weeks, the NBA fan has taken over me and pushed the fantasy fan aside. I mean, if you are a true sports fan, how can you not be on the edge of your seat as we enter the last few weeks of the regular season? At the time I’m writing this (Friday afternoon, before the games) only seven games separate #1 from #9 in the West. And #10 isn’t out of it yet either. This is great.
Have we seen a better race to the finish in any sport? Baseball is always close because so few teams make it. But could a team sitting in 9th today end up in the Finals? It’s not out of the realm of possibility. This year was a HUGE win for the NBA. They stayed away from any controversy (Spygate and steroids anyone?) and pulled off a huge humanitarian effort/All-Star Weekend. What a great year it’s been and kudos to David Stern and all his people in the league office.
